The Role Of Technology In Globalization

Technology is a vital force that drives the modern form of business globalization. The technology has revolutionized itself and has become a critical competitive strategy to take their business to the global market.

Globalization has led to new markets and information technology. It has become a medium for the different countries to communicate with each other other than trade.

Technology has helped us in overcoming the major hurdles of globalization and international trade. This includes – 

  • Trade barriers.
  • Uplifting the common ethical standard.
  • Reducing the transportation cost.
  • Preventing delay in information exchange.

Technology has enabled professionals to work collaboratively over the network with companies from around the world. In fact, technological advancement has helped creators to work on their creations and showcase them for the world to see.

Markets have become global at a rapid pace; this shows you how industries are targeting global audiences. However, this can only be possible if they can tap into globalization.

The market researchers have analyzed the global market. They have concluded that technology has globalized the business, and the countries that have most benefited from it are the developed countries.

While technology has created many opportunities, it is important to look at the friction in the system. This will help the industry understand the concept of globalization and will be prepared for the challenges that come with it.

If we can summarize the role of technology, it will look like this – 

  • Advancement in the transport sectors helping with export and import.
  • The system of exchange will become faster.
  • Transmission technology helps transfer information to different parts of the world in seconds.
  • Telecommunication has increased the connection between individuals and organizations.

1. Research Tools

Use research tools to analyze your customers and what they want from your brand and business. For instance, you can take help from Google trends to see what is trending in your industry. This will help you gauge the demand of the market and consumer barometer.

While Google trends show you the region, it might not suggest different keywords. For that, you can always go for tools like SEMrush and Ahrefs. These two are considered all-around data analytic tools that help individuals get even the smallest data about the market and their competitors.

5. Resource Management Tool

There are plenty of software tools that help business manage their resources. They show their potential by managing your budget, time, and human resource.

Resource management tools are great for managing remote work, tracking time, communication among the team members, and resources.

Some of the popular tools are –

  • Wrike.
  • Basecamp.
  • Monday.com.
